WEST VALLEY COLLEGE
Website | Map

School District Represented: East Side Union High School District

An emphasis of the Valdés Institute is to prepare students for success in Algebra I. At WVC, however, our focus shifts as we place our top class (Math Analysis) of high school students there to give them an opportunity to be at a campus many of them may not have considered after their high school career. These students also have the opportunity to meet with their peers on Fridays at another college campus.
